SSGC clinch Naya Nazimabad Football title
By PPI
June 15, 2021
KARACHI: Sui Southern Gas Company won the Naya Nazimabad Football Tournament by defeating Civil Aviation Authority by 1-0 after an interesting and thrilling climax here at Naya Nazimabad Football Stadium on Saturday night.
The summit clash began with an aggressive approach from both sides. Both teams made several attempts to score but failed. The first half ended with out any goal being scored. In the 82nd minute of the game, Abdul Waheed produced the decisive goal of the final.
Before the final, a match was played between Media XI and Veterans XI which ended in a 5-5 draw. Bilal Hussain and Zahid Ghaffar both scored two goals each to help Media XI recover from 0-4 down to eventually draw the match.
